Eikosany: Microtonal Algorithmic Composition with R
Eikosany is an R package for composing microtonal electronic music based on the theories of Erv Wilson. It gives a composer the ability to
create compositions using a wide variety of microtonal scales,
manipulate the scores as R data.table objects,
synthesize the compositions as audio files, and
export the compositions as MIDI files to digital audio workstations.
In this talk I'll briefly describe the music theory behind Eikosany and walk through a typical composition scenario. At the end, I'll play the resulting composition.
Speaker Bio:
M. Edward (Ed) Borasky is a retired scientific applications and operating systems programmer who has been using R since version 0.90.1 on Red Hat Linux 6.2.* Before R there was Fortran and assembler - lots of different assemblers. (Floating Point Systems AP-120B microcode, even.)
Besides his main professional use for R, Linux performance analysis and capacity planning, Ed has used R for computational finance, fantasy basketball analytics, and now, algorithmic composition. His music is best defined as experimental, combining algorithmic composition, microtonal scales, and spectral sound design.
